新建家修网

arm编程配置·arm编程用哪个软件

admin 0

各位老铁们好,相信很多人对arm编程配置都不是特别的了解,因此呢,今天就来为大家分享下关于arm编程配置以及armbian编程的问题知识,还望可以帮助大家,解决大家的一些困惑,下面一起来看看吧!

一、arm编程配置

1.1 配置ADB确保已安装ADB工具,并开启Android设备的USB调试模式。

2.基础环境搭建安装必要插件:在VSCode中下载C/C++、C/C++ Snippets、ARM汇编语法高亮、Cortex-Debug等插件,提供代码编辑、语法高亮和调试支持。配置本地编译工具链:若需本地编译,安装gcc-arm-none-eabi工具链(适用于裸机或RTOS开发),并配置环境变量确保命令行可调用。

3.使用蓝宙ARM仿真器下载程序需完成硬件连接、驱动安装、编程环境配置三步,具体操作如下:硬件准备与连接工具准备:蓝宙ARM仿真器、USB数据线、10p/20p排线或杜邦线(根据目标板接口选择)。接口匹配:仿真器支持SWD接口,兼容Cortex-M0/M0+/M3/M4/A7内核单片机。

二、在Android上运行Go程序ARM架构编译与部署指南

1.部署在非x86架构的服务器或嵌入式设备。示例代码与命令 package mainimport ";fmt";func main() { fmt.Println(";Hello, GCCGO!";)}编译运行:gccgo -o hello hello.go./hello 选择建议优先gc:若项目无特殊需求,gc是默认选择,兼顾稳定性、性能和生态。

2.在 Windows 11 系统中运行安卓应用需通过嵌入的子系统实现,以下是详细操作指南:前提条件硬件要求 内存:最低 8GB,推荐 16GB。存储:固态硬盘(SSD)。处理器:Core i3 8th Gen、Ryzen Snapdragon 8c 或更高版本。处理器类型:x64 或 ARM64。

3. 理解运行机制Android设备基于ARM架构处理器,系统底层为Linux内核。Go语言支持交叉编译,可直接生成针对GOOS=android和GOARCH=arm/arm64的二进制文件,无需封装为完整Android应用。

三、vscode配置armlinux开发环境

1.安装VSCode,并使用快捷键安装C++、CMake Tools等扩展。配置VSCodeLinux开发环境:参考VS Code的Linux子系统教程进行配置,确保VSCode能够正确识别和使用WSL2中的Linux环境。安装CMake及必要工具:确保安装CMake,并安装必要的工具,如wget和SSL证书。

2.要在VSCode中配置远程开发环境以及Linux虚拟机开发环境,可以按照以下步骤进行:前期准备 安装VSCode:确保已在本地计算机上安装了Microsoft VSCode。安装RemoteSSH插件:在VSCode中安装RemoteSSH插件,以便实现远程连接。

3.在Linux上使用Visual Studio Code进行工业自动化开发的推荐配置如下:安装与基础环境配置首先通过包管理器安装VS Code,例如Ubuntu/Debian系统执行命令:sudo apt update && sudo apt install code安装完成后,建议通过命令行code直接启动,或从应用菜单启动。

4.Linux:Debian/Ubuntu:sudo apt install dmd(或ldc/gdc)。Arch Linux:sudo pacman -S dmd。验证安装打开命令行,输入以下命令确认版本信息:dmd --versiondub --version 配置VS Code开发环境安装扩展 在VS Code扩展商店搜索并安装code-d,提供语法高亮、智能提示、调试支持等功能。

四、如何使用蓝宙ARM仿真器下载程序

1. 产品说明与驱动安装兼容性确认:ARM仿真器支持带SWD接口的Cortex-M0/M0+/M3/M4/A7等内核单片机,兼容KEIL、IAR等编译环境。驱动安装:以蓝宙ARM仿真器为例,默认MBED模式下需安装驱动:通过USB线连接电脑,运行资料文件夹中的mbedWinSerial_exe完成安装,设备管理器中会显示对应端口。

2.下载程序:编译工程生成.hex或.bin文件。点击KEIL的“Load”按钮,程序将通过仿真器下载到目标板。指示灯提示:下载过程中仿真器的LED灯会闪烁,成功完成后常亮。其他固件模式(可选)若需使用JLINK或P&E模式,需刷写对应固件:将仿真器切换至DFU模式(按住复位键再连接USB)。

arm编程配置的介绍到此告一段落了,希望这篇文章能够帮助到您。如果您还想了解,请继续关注。